This helicopter tower is prepared to remove the patrol helicopter from the map or use various related add-ons.
It is prepared with several automatic lighting systems:
automatic lights at night thanks to solar panels.
It has lights for the upper part with 10-minute timer and also 10-minute heaters for arctic areas,
window opening system in the central area of the tower.
And a 6-story elevator to the top.
All well lit if you flip the switches.
912 prefabs.

Prefab FAQ – How do I host this .zip/.7z file I just purchased on my server?
• First, you want to unzip the file. You can do so by just double-clicking it to open, then drag the contents to the desired location (you may need to install an external unzipping software if you don’t already have one)
• Next you will find either a structure of folders or just the .prefab files (it’s the important ones).
• You can then open your map via Rustedit (How to install Rustedit)
• Then install those .prefab files into your …/rustedit/CustomPrefabs folder
• Launch Rustedit and open your map and within the ‘Prefabs’ list you should see the new prefab/monument you downloaded once you search its name
